AIM 360 is a mobile vehicle inspection and condition report app developed by Pantera Mobile Applications LLC. It focuses on using an iPhone or iPad to collect vehicle information, document photos, and generate PDF reports within minutes. Its target users include car rental companies, towing and roadside assistance providers, dealerships, auctions, salvage yards, vehicle appraisers, transport companies, and light fleet management teams.
The product is built around the vehicle inspection workflow. It can scan VIN barcodes and QR codes with the camera, or recognize text on door jamb labels, then automatically decode fields such as year, make, model, trim, engine, transmission, GVWR, fuel type, and more. It also supports capturing odometer readings, license plates, vehicle damage photos, damage location and severity, vehicle options, fuel level, keys, tire brand and tread depth, GPS address, date and time. Reports can be exported as branded PDF files with a Logo and shared via email or messaging services.
After subscribing to AIM 360, vehicle condition reports and photos can be stored in the cloud and accessed online through the AIM 360 Portal. The Portal offers an email-like interface for viewing inventory, printing reports, downloading photos, editing vehicle details, and more. For teams, larger companies can create a company account, generate a company code for employees, and add or remove users. In terms of pricing, only an individual monthly subscription is disclosed, purchased in-app under Company/Subscription; the official website does not provide specific prices or plan differences.
The privacy policy states that account information, contact details, usage data, location, camera access, and photo library information may be collected, and may be uploaded to the companyβs or service providersβ servers. The text also references GDPR and CCPA-related definitions. However, it does not disclose enterprise-grade security details such as encryption, permission auditing, or backup policies. For third-party integrations, the available information only shows PDF sharing via email or messaging; there is no visible information about an open API, Webhooks, or DMS/CRM integrations.
Its strengths are a strong focus on a vertical use case, rich data capture fields, no need for extra hardware, and machine recognition that can reduce manual entry. The Web Portal is also useful for managing multi-vehicle inventory. Limitations include clear availability only on the Apple App Store, no Android information, opaque pricing, and limited disclosure around integration and security capabilities. AIM 360 is better suited to dealerships, rental operators, and auction teams that primarily use iOS devices and need fast, standardized vehicle inspection reports.
The official website does not disclose accessibility of the website or service in China, supported payment methods, or Chinese-language support, so these remain unknown. For deployment in China, key points to verify include App Store regional availability, cloud access stability, payment methods, and VIN decoding coverage for Chinese vehicle models. Alternatives may include domestic vehicle asset management systems, used-car inspection and appraisal tools, or dealer inventory management platforms.
